How Pruning and Mulching Work Together After Stump Removal
After stump removal, the landscape often looks uneven because roots, ground disturbance, and debris can leave patches where plants struggle to establish. A coordinated plan—removal, ground preparation, and mulching—helps you move from clearance to a stable, attractive garden outcome. By addressing the surrounding conditions, you support new growth and avoid the “bare ground” look that can take multiple landscaping sessions to fix.
Tree mulching is also useful for managing garden edges and pathways where soil may become exposed. A professional will typically select the correct mulch type and apply it to appropriate depths to prevent overly compacted layers. This matters because incorrect mulching can trap moisture against stems or create barriers that slow water movement into the soil.
